The Evolution of Purple as a Color
Historically, purple has been tied to royalty and luxury, largely due to the difficult process of producing purple dye from mollusks, making it accessible only to the wealthiest individuals. In spiritual contexts, purple often represents the divine and the mystical, bridging the earthly and the celestial. Over time, it has become a powerful symbol in various religious traditions, linked closely with enlightenment and higher consciousness.
